Charlie, a notorious serial killer known as the Midnight Mangler finds himself trapped, reliving the same violent night over and over. Initially embracing his grisly urges, Charlie soon becomes desperate to escape the endless nightmare.
2024
2023
2022
2004
2016
2018
2003
2017
1988
—
2020
2013